Solana (SOL): Bullish Momentum Falters Near Key Resistance

Earlier this week, Solana showed strong bullish momentum, with price predictions suggesting a possible run to $200. However, the rally stalled at $189, failing to break through critical resistance. Since then, price action has weakened, raising concerns about a potential correction.

On the 4-hour SOL/USD chart, the 20-period Exponential Moving Average (EMA) crossed above the 50-period EMA on May 15—a classic sign of bullish momentum. As of the latest update, this bullish alignment remains intact. Yet, a critical red flag has emerged: Solana’s price is currently trading below both moving averages. This divergence suggests weakening buyer control and casts doubt on the sustainability of the uptrend.

Technical analysts refer to this scenario as a "bullish invalidation." When price fails to hold above key EMAs after a crossover, it often precedes a deeper pullback. In SOL’s case, such a scenario could push the price down toward the $159.50 support level—a zone that previously acted as strong demand. If selling pressure intensifies and volume increases on down-candles, that target becomes more likely.

However, a return above both EMAs would reconfirm bullish sentiment and could reignite buying interest toward $195 and beyond. Traders should monitor volume trends and watch for a decisive close above $189 to signal renewed strength.


Toncoin (TON): Bull Run Gaining Strength

While many altcoins struggle, Toncoin (TON) continues to demonstrate resilient upward momentum. Over recent weeks, TON has outperformed much of the market, drawing attention from both retail and institutional investors.

Current technical patterns suggest that TON could climb toward $6.75 in the short term. This projection is supported by sustained buying volume and a series of higher lows forming on the daily chart. Additionally, the Relative Strength Index (RSI) remains in bullish territory—hovering just below 70—indicating strong demand without yet entering overbought extremes.

The network’s growing adoption in messaging-integrated Web3 services and mini-app ecosystems on Telegram adds fundamental weight to the bullish case. With millions of users potentially gaining exposure to TON-based services through Telegram’s 900 million+ user base, on-chain activity continues to rise.

That said, traders should remain cautious of sudden profit-taking if price approaches $6.75. That level aligns with previous resistance and may trigger sell orders. A breakout above this point with high volume would open the path toward $7.20.

Cardano (ADA): Death Cross Signals Downside Risk

Cardano’s technical picture presents a more bearish outlook. A "death cross" has formed on ADA’s weekly chart—the 50-week EMA has dropped below the 200-week EMA—historically signaling prolonged downtrends.

While weekly indicators carry long-term weight, shorter timeframes reinforce the cautionary tone. On the daily chart, ADA has failed multiple times to reclaim the $0.50 level. Each rejection has been followed by deeper corrections, indicating persistent selling pressure.

The most immediate support lies at $0.43. If bearish momentum accelerates—especially in a broader market downturn—ADA could test this level in the coming weeks. A breakdown below $0.43 might extend losses toward $0.38, particularly if Bitcoin enters a consolidation or decline phase.

That said, positive developments around smart contract adoption on Cardano or new decentralized application launches could spark a reversal. For now, however, the path of least resistance appears downward.

Investors should watch for stabilization near support zones and any sign of volume-backed reversal patterns—such as bullish engulfing candles or RSI divergence—before considering new long positions.


Cosmos (ATOM): Capital Inflows Signal Potential Breakout

Cosmos (ATOM) stands out as a token showing strong accumulation signals. On-chain data reveals increasing money flow into ATOM wallets, particularly on exchanges with large institutional presence.

This accumulation phase often precedes significant price movements. Analysts project that if buying pressure continues, ATOM could reach $8.74—a level not seen since early 2022. Such a move would represent over 60% upside from current levels.

Technically, ATOM is consolidating within a tight range between $5.20 and $5.60. A breakout above $5.60 with strong volume could trigger a cascade of algorithmic and momentum-driven buys. The 20-day EMA is flattening but beginning to turn upward, hinting at shifting sentiment.

The broader narrative around Cosmos’ interchain security model and its role in enabling scalable, interoperable blockchains adds fundamental strength. As modular blockchain architecture gains traction, Cosmos’ ecosystem is well-positioned to benefit.

For traders, a confirmed close above $5.60 would be the first confirmation of bullish continuation.

Q: What is a death cross, and why is it important for ADA?
A: A death cross occurs when the 50-day moving average falls below the 200-day moving average, signaling long-term bearish momentum. For Cardano, this pattern suggests increased risk of further declines unless strong buying emerges.
